The City of Marco Island is working on the Tigertail Lagoon/Sand Dollar Island Ecosystem Restoration Project, a coastal protection and nature-based project located on Marco Island, Florida. The project aims to restore a 2-mile sand spit, coastal lagoon, and mangrove shorelines to protect the area from storms and restore wildlife habitat.
